Building work was started on this small church in the 12th Century. Originally designed as a modest place of worship, the church became famous after it was found that it contained a piece of the skull of St. Lazarus. It was believed that this relic could cure leprosy and therefore visitors flocked from far and wide to visit the church. In order to deal with the vast numbers of people, the church had to be enlarged in the 13th Century.
